Where Can I Find Cavalier King Charles Spaniels in Iowa?
Finding a healthy and well-bred Cavalier King Charles Spaniel in Iowa requires research and careful consideration. Your best bet is to start with reputable breeders who prioritize the health and temperament of their dogs. Avoid puppy mills and backyard breeders, as these often produce dogs with health problems and behavioral issues. Look for breeders who:
- Health test their breeding dogs: Reputable breeders conduct genetic testing to screen for common Cavalier health concerns like mitral valve disease (MVD) and syringomyelia (SM).
- Provide health records: They should be transparent about the health history of both parents and puppies.
- Socialize their puppies: Well-socialized puppies are more confident and adaptable.
- Are knowledgeable about the breed: A good breeder will be able to answer your questions about the breed's temperament, care requirements, and potential health issues.
You can find potential breeders through breed-specific clubs like the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Club, USA, or online directories. Remember to always visit breeders in person to meet the parents and puppies and assess the breeding environment.

What Should I Expect When Buying a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Puppy in Iowa?
Bringing home a Cavalier King Charles Spaniel puppy is an exciting experience! Be prepared for the commitment involved in caring for a dog. This includes:
- Financial costs: Factor in the initial cost of the puppy, as well as ongoing expenses for food, veterinary care, grooming, and toys.
- Time commitment: Cavaliers need regular exercise, training, and socialization. Be prepared to dedicate time to your dog's needs.
- Training and socialization: Early training and socialization are crucial for a well-adjusted adult dog. Consider enrolling your puppy in obedience classes.
What are the Common Health Problems of Cavalier King Charles Spaniels?
Cavalier King Charles Spaniels are prone to certain health conditions, including:
- Mitral Valve Disease (MVD): A heart condition affecting many Cavaliers.
- Syringomyelia (SM): A neurological disorder that can cause pain and neurological symptoms.
- Epilepsy: Seizures can occur in some Cavaliers.
Reputable breeders actively screen for these conditions, significantly reducing the risk for their puppies. Understanding these potential health issues is important for responsible ownership. Discuss any concerns with your breeder or veterinarian.
How Much Does a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Cost in Iowa?
The cost of a Cavalier King Charles Spaniel in Iowa will vary depending on the breeder, the puppy's lineage, and its characteristics. Be prepared to pay several hundred to over a thousand dollars for a puppy from a reputable breeder. Remember that the price reflects the breeder's commitment to health testing, responsible breeding practices, and the puppy's well-being.
How Do I Find a Reputable Breeder?
Finding a reputable breeder involves thorough research. Start by looking for breeders who are members of reputable breed clubs and organizations. They are often more likely to adhere to ethical breeding practices and prioritize the health of their dogs. Check online reviews and speak with other Cavalier owners to get recommendations. Visiting a breeder in person to see their facilities and meet their dogs is crucial before making a decision.
